Atalanta and Chievo meet at Stadio Atleti Azzurri d'Italia, in a match for the 23th round of the Serie A. These teams have tied (1‑1) in the last head‑to‑head for this edition of the league, played on 17‑09‑2017. At this stadium, the head‑to‑head history favours the home team, since they have a record of 4 wins and 2 draws in the last 6 matches. Sure enough, the last time these teams met at this stadium, on 27‑05‑2017, in a match for the Serie A, Atalanta won by (1‑0). The only goal of the match was scored by A. Gómez (52' ). In this match the home advantage may play an important role, since Chievo presents significant differences between home and away performances.

Analysis Atalanta

After 9 wins, 6 draws and 7 losses, the home team is in the 8th position, havinf won 33 points so far. In the last match, they have won in an away match against Sassuolo by (0‑3), after in the previous match they have lost (0‑1) at home, against Napoli. This is a team that usually maintains its competitive level in home and away matches, since in the last 30 matches they register 6 wins, 5 draws and 4 losses in away matches, with 24 goals scored and 19 conceded; against 9 wins, 3 draws and 3 losses at their stadium, with 28 goals scored and 14 conceded. In their last match, for the Coppa Italia, they got a home loss against Juventus by (0‑1). In the last 10 home league matches Atalanta has a record of 5 wins, 3 draws and 2 losses, so they have won 18 points out of 30 possible. In their home league matches the most frequent result at half‑time was the 0‑0 (4 out of 11 matches). They haven't been very strong defensively, since they have suffered goals in 7 of the last 10 matches, but their offense has scored frequently, since they have scored goals in 8 of the last 10 matches for this competition. In 22 matches for this competition, they have conceded the first goal 10 times and have only turned the score around in 2. there is 1 period that stands out in the last 11 home matches for this competition: they have suffered 5 of their 12 goals between minutes (16'‑30').

Atalanta is in a reasonably comfortable situation within the Italian Championship, but has been performing somewhat curious, having won the last four away games while losing the last two at home. In the last round, the team had a good performance against Sassuolo, having missed a few passes and showed a lot of consistency in the midfield, then defeating the opponent, with highlight for Freuler, who made a great display and also scored a goal. As it was possible to notice in this confrontation, the offensive sector has been acting in a satisfactory way, so much so that it is among the seven best in the competition. Another strong point of the team has been possession of the ball, in which case it has the sixth best average, thus hindering the opponent's work. For this clash, it is likely that the coach will organize the team in 3-4-2-1, with Gomez standing out in the offensive sector.

Analysis Chievo

The away team is currently in the 13th position of the league, with 22 points won, after 5 wins, 7 draws and 10 losses. In the penultimate match, they lost in an away match against Lazio, by (5‑1). In the last match, they lost in a home match against Juventus, by (0‑2). This is a team that usually makes good use of the home advantage, stronger with the help of its supporters, since in the last 30 matches they register 3 wins, 5 draws and 7 losses in away matches, with 14 goals scored and 28 conceded; against 6 wins, 5 draws and 4 losses at their stadium, with 24 goals scored and 19 conceded. In the last 10 away league matches Chievo has a record of 1 win, 3 draws and 6 losses, so they have won 6 points out of 30 possible.

In this competition, they have a sequence of 4 losses in the last away matches and they haven't won any of the last 7 away matches. In their away league matches the most frequent result at half‑time was the 0‑0 (4 out of 11 matches). Defensive consistency hasn’t been their best feature, as they have conceded goals in 9 of the last 10 matches for this competition. This is a team that has had a hard time trying to score first. They have opened up the score in only 5 of the last 22 matches for the Serie A, and have never reached half‑time in front. In 22 matches for this competition, they have conceded the first goal 14 times and have only turned the score around in 3.

Chievo has managed to build up some good results in the opening rounds of the Italian Championship, but is now in a very difficult phase as it has not won for eight games and suffered six defeats in that period. The last of them occurred at home against Juventus in a game where it had a poor performance, having finished only once, and finished with two players expelled, further facilitating the life of the opponent, which is naturally much better. As was evident in this confrontation, the offensive sector has had many difficulties to do its work efficiently, and now figures as the sixth worst in the competition. Playing away from its dominions, the team owns the fourth worst campaign, and in that condition failed to score goals in five games. A 3-5-1-1 should be the tactical formation of choice for this bout, which will not have the presence of Cacciatore and Bastien, both suspended.
